InterContinental Paris - Le Grand vs Le Meurice
Both InterContinental Paris Le Grand and Le Meurice are rated very highly by professional reviewers. On balance, Le Meurice scores significantly higher than InterContinental Paris Le Grand. Le Meurice comes in at #4 in Paris with praise from 20 sources like Gayot, BlackBook and Travel + Leisure.
